Dad Accused In Girl's Death On Suicide Watch

POSTED: 9:46 am MST November 5, 2009
UPDATED: 11:30 am MST November 5, 2009

A Glendale father accused of mowing down his daughter because she was too Westernized is now on suicide watch, canceling his Thursday arraignment, authorities said.

Prosecutors were expected file harsher charges against Faleh Hassan Almaleki, 48, in the death of his daughter, 20-year-old Noor Faleh Almaleki.

Faleh Almaleki, an Iraqi immigrant, was originally charged with two counts of aggravated assault.

Peoria Police Department spokesman Mike Tellef said detectives and prosecutors with the Maricopa County Attorney's Office are determining what the new charges against Almaleki will be.

Almaleki is accused of using his Jeep Grand Cherokee to run down his daughter and her friend, 43-year-old Amal Edan Khalaf, in a parking lot in Peoria Oct. 20.

Almaleki fled the country, but U.K. Port of Entry authorities denied him entry into London. He was put on a flight back to the U.S., and authorities arrested him upon his arrival in Atlanta

County prosecutors a judge during a weekend hearing that Almaleki admitted to committing the crime.

Khalaf remains in serious but stable condition, police said.
